description Product Description

Used extensively in cellular metabolism, this compound plays a critical role in energy production by facilitating electron transfer in redox reactions. It is essential in processes like glycolysis, the citric acid cycle, and oxidative phosphorylation, helping convert nutrients into ATP. Additionally, it is utilized in research to study enzyme kinetics and cellular signaling pathways. In biotechnology, it is employed in assays to measure enzymatic activity and in the production of biofuels. Its involvement in DNA repair mechanisms also makes it significant in studies related to aging and cancer.
